Before diving into the solutions, it is essential to understand how data leakage can occur when using proxies. When using a proxy, the communication between the user and the destination server is routed through a third-party server. If the proxy server is misconfigured, malicious, or compromised, sensitive data such as passwords, browsing habits, and even financial information can be leaked.
Two main scenarios of data leakage include:
1. IP Address and Geolocation Exposure: Even when a proxy is used, a user's real IP address or geolocation can be exposed due to misconfigurations or weaknesses in the proxy’s design.
2. Unencrypted Traffic: Some proxies fail to properly encrypt traffic between the user and the proxy server. If this happens, sensitive data can be intercepted by hackers during transmission.
Understanding these risks is crucial in taking the appropriate measures to secure the data.
Proper configuration of the proxy server is the first step to ensure data security. Both Pyproxy and 911 Proxy offer powerful capabilities but require careful setup.
- Use Strong Authentication: Always configure strong authentication methods to prevent unauthorized access to the proxy server. Using multi-factor authentication (MFA) will add an extra layer of protection.
- Force Encryption (HTTPS): Ensure that the proxy server supports HTTPS, which encrypts the data in transit. This prevents data from being intercepted by cybercriminals. Avoid using proxies that only support HTTP, as the lack of encryption makes data vulnerable.
- Disable WebRTC: WebRTC (Web Real-Time Communication) is a protocol used by browsers for real-time communication. Unfortunately, it can also leak the user's real IP address even when a proxy is in use. Disabling WebRTC in the browser settings can prevent this leak.

One of the most effective ways to prevent data leakage is by using a Virtual Private Network (VPN) in conjunction with a proxy.
- Encrypt Data on Both Ends: A VPN will encrypt your internet traffic before it reaches the proxy server, and the proxy server will route the encrypted data to its destination. This provides an additional layer of encryption, significantly reducing the risk of data being intercepted.
- Secure DNS Requests: When using both a VPN and a proxy, ensure that DNS queries are also encrypted to prevent DNS leaks, which could reveal your browsing activity. Using DNS-over-HTTPS or DNS-over-TLS is a good way to achieve this.
- Avoid DNS Leaks: Proxy and VPN usage should be combined with leak protection measures. Some proxies and VPN services offer built-in DNS leak protection that ensures no sensitive information is exposed.
